ESTATE OF DAVIDSON v. COMMISSIONER

Docket No. 4135.

5 T.C.M. 53 (1946)

Estate of Walter Davidson, Deceased, Gordon M. Davidson and First Wisconsin Trust Company, Executors of the Estate of Walter Davidson, Deceased v. Commissioner.

United States Tax Court.

Entered January 31, 1946.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Raymond T. Zillmer, Esq., 1412 First Wisconsin Nat. Bank Bldg., Milwaukee 2, Wis., for the petitioners. Carroll Walker, Esq., for the respondent.


Memorandum Findings of Fact and Opinion

The Commissioner determined a deficiency in the income tax of Walter Davidson, petitioners' decedent, for the calendar year 1941, in the amount of $4,715.30, resulting from the disallowance of a claimed loss on the sale of a house and lots.
